Up In The Air, Junior Birdman
This MGM short is about the stars who like to fly. In fact, the sizable income of even faded stars was sufficient to let them buy air planes and pilot them themselves. It's an excuse to show well known personalities in their civilian lives.
It's written by Marion Mack, now best remembered for playing Buster Keaton's love interest in THE GENERAL. She scripted four shorts in total, one of which, STREAMLINED SWING, was directed by Keaton.
